City Barrel Brewing
Voted Best Brewery by the Pitch
City Barrel is a niche brewery in the Crossroads District of Kansas City specializing in hoppy, wild and sour beer. The backdrop behind the bar is made of reclaimed wood from the world famous Nelson Atkins Museum of Art. The wood was installed in 1930 as gallery walls, until it was removed during a renovation in 2017. If you look closely, you can see many holes in the wood. The holes are from nails that hung priceless works of art.
Unlike many breweries in Kansas City, City Barrel Brewing has a full food, wine and craft cocktail menu in addition to its craft beer selections. Enjoy seasonal entrees prepared by Chef Benjamin Wood.
